Abstract
An overturn structure of a footstep of a folding ladder, includes a footstep is disposed between two legs, wherein further comprising two pivot elements and a reinforcing bar connecting between the two legs, the pivot elements are respectively connected to both ends of the reinforcing bar, the pivot elements are pivoted joint to the footstep to make the footstep overturn about the reinforcing bar to fold and unfold, when the footstep is unfolded, the reinforcing bar is supported on the bottom portion of the footstep. The pivot elements are connected to the reinforcing bar, the pivot elements are pivoted joint to the footstep, the footstep can rotate about the reinforcing bar to fold and unfold, so that the structure is stable, when the footstep is unfolded, the reinforcing bar is supported on the bottom portion of the footstep, it thus significantly improves the bearing performance of the footstep.
Claims
1. A folding ladder comprising: two legs; a reinforcing bar, the reinforcing bar located between the two legs and defining a length; a footstep disposed between the two legs, the footstep having a width substantially corresponding to the length of the reinforcing bar, a bottom portion and two arc shaped lock grooves on the bottom portion; and two pivot elements, each of the two pivot elements having a fixation portion and a connecting portion resulting in two fixation portions and two connecting portions, each of the fixation portions being riveted to the reinforcing bar, each of the fixation portions having a convex outer edge, each of the connecting portions having a concave inner surface for engaging the convex outer edge, and an external arc shaped surface corresponding to a respective one of the arc shaped lock grooves, and the two connecting portions respectively inserted into the two arc shaped lock grooves on the bottom portion, the arc shaped lock grooves respectively configured to rotate about the reinforcing bar.
2. The folding ladder according to claim 1, wherein the connecting portion is distal from the fixation portion.
3. The folding ladder according to claim 1, wherein a center portion of the reinforcing bar is arch shaped.
